I've been to Disney a lot but never with extended family members! Our two families want to have all the same reservations. How do we go about getting ADR's for a table of 7 with our two different MDE accounts?
Thanks for any help with this!
 
You don't have to use two different MDE's to make the ADR's. In fact, that would complicate things, to use both to make the ADR's. Put one person in charge of the ADR's and then link the accounts within MDE by marking each other as friends or family. I don't remember as much about how to do that part, but you can absolutely make ADR's for large parties using only one account. I just did this last week for a party of ten using only my MDE account, no one else's. The only thing you might want to do is figure out ahead of time if you have any really difficult ADR's to get, like Be Our Guest, and then split into two parties to do that one. I know it's not always necessary to do that, but I was not able to get a dinner ADR for ten people for the 6th or 7th day of our trip at my 180 + 10, immediately after the phone lines opened. This was my first time making ADR's, so I'm sure others have more advice, but just my recent experience.
